    What's the best timing to run a ul-1s with a 120a turnigy esc 6 pole (stock motor) 2030kv on 4s 4000 lipos
    Running stock prop...and L38x55
    Choices....0..3.75...7.5...11.25...15...18.75...22 .5...26.25

    Timing on the stock UL-1 controller is 10 degrees. I would bet the 11.25 setting would be fine. Make sure you check temps for the first few runs...

    It depends on the load on the motor. You won't see a dramatic difference with normal props. I've run my FE-30 on 10 and 15 degrees and most times see no difference in speed or heat.
